Caricature

Webster's Dictionary of the English Language

·vt An exaggeration, or distortion by exaggeration, of parts or characteristics, as in a picture.

II. Caricature ·vt To make or draw a caricature of; to represent with ridiculous exaggeration; to Burlesque.

III. Caricature ·vt A picture or other figure or description in which the peculiarities of a person or thing are so exaggerated as to appear ridiculous; a burlesque; a parody.
